Prime coat composition on loose-surface ground and construction process thereof
Provided are a prime coat composition on loose-surface ground and a construction process thereof, wherein the prime coat composition comprises a component A and a component B, wherein the component Acontains epoxy resin, a diluent and a flexibilizer, and the component B contains a curing agent and a coupling agent, and the prime coat composition further comprises a component C and a component D;the prime coat composition further comprises a component C comprising waterborne epoxy resin, a curing agent and a defoaming agent, and the viscosity is 1.5-5 times that of normal-temperature water; the prime coat composition further comprises the component D comprising the components in parts by weight: 15 parts of calcium oxide powder, 5 parts of polypropylene fibers with the length of 30-50 mm,35 parts of primary silica fume, and 45 parts of water. After the component D is poured, the component C is pressed and injected to the ground by utilizing pressure. In this way, the ground with theloose surface structure can be effectively bonded together. And the overall structural strength and the construction efficiency are improved.
